Xilinx Spartan 3E DevBoard  

Mijn eigen Xilinx Spartan 3E starters kit.

SP3e Kit

Key Components and Features

  • Xilinx XC3S500E Spartan-3E
    1. Up to 232 user-I/O pins
    2. 320-pin FBGA package
    3. Over 10,000 logic cells
  • Xilinx 4Mbit Platform Flash configuration PROM
  • Xilinx 64-macrocell XC2C64 CoolRunner CPLD
  • 64 Megabytes of DDR SDRAM, x16 data interface, 100+ MHz
  • 16 Megabytes of parallel NOR Flash (Intel StrataFlash)
    1. FPGA configuration storage
    2. MicroBlaze code storage/shadowing
  • 16 Megabits of SPI serial Flash (STMicro)
    1. FPGA configuration storage
    2. MicroBlaze code shadowing
  • 2-line, 16-character LCD display
  • PS/2 Mouse/keyboard board
  • VGA display port
  • 10/100 Ethernet PHY (required Ethernet MAC in FPGA)
  • Two 9-pin RS-232 ports (DTE- and DCE-style)
  • On-board USB-based FPGA/CPLD download/debug interface
  • 50 MHz clock oscillator
  • SHA-1 1-wire serial EEPROM for bitstream copy protection
  • Digilent FX2 expansion connector
  • Three Digilent 6-pin expansion connectors
  • Four-output, SPI-based Digital-to-Analog Converter (DAC)
  • Two-input, SPI-based Analog-to-Digital Converter (ADC) with programmable-gain pre-amplifier
  • ChipScope SoftTouch debugging port
  • Rotary-encoder with push button shaft
  • Eight discrete LEDs
  • Four slide switches
  • Four push button switches
  • SMA clock input 8-pin DIP socket for auxiliary clock oscillator

Alle Source Codes zijn

- Char LCD aansturing.
- rotor switch readout
- VGA output generator on SP3E.
- old version of VGA output generator on SP3.
  • VGA Project Dit project genereert een 4-bit kleuren VGA scherm.
    Charaters (8x8px) worden gegenereerd uit een PC charater rom.
    Via de Seriele poort kan de tekstbuffer gevult worden.
    data-packet <8-bit>Charater<8-Bit)voor/achtergrond kleur: net als bij DOS.
  • Char LCD aansturing Dit is een test project om het LCD aan te sturen.
  • Rotor Switch uitlezen Dit is een test project om de rotor switch uit te lezen.
    Ik heb wel heb hardware matige debounce toegepast door 100nF parallel over de schakelaars te solderen.
  Xilinx Spartan 3 DevBoard  
Met deze kit werk ik op me werk mee. Avnet Xilinx Spartan 3 PCI board.
Deze kit heeft onboard.
SP3 PCI kit
Wat Omschrijving Merk & Type
Porten 2x PS2  
  1x Sub-D 15p  
  1x Sub-D 9p  
  1x Parallel Port  
  2x Avnet board connectors  
  1x Header 2x25p  
  1x RJ45 for Ethernet 10/100MBit  
  1x 32Bits PCI connector  
IC's 1x FPGA Spartan Xilinx - XC3S400-4FG456C
  1x Video DAC Analoge Analog - ADV7125KST50
  2x 1Mx4bit SRAM Crypress - CY7C1041CV33-15ZC
  1x I²C EEPROM 256KBit Atmel - AT24C256N-10SI
  2x PROM Xilinx 1M & 4M Xilinx - XCF01S & XCF04S
  1x Ethernet 10/100Mbit National - DP83846AVHG
  1x RS232 Maxim - MAX232
<
  USB Programmer  
Om de FPGA te programmeren heb je een programmer nodig.
Je kan er een maken die via de parallel poort werkt.
Of als je veel geld heb koop je de Platform Cable USB II van Xilinx.
Deze is een heel stuk sneller en omdat je steeds minder parallele poorten nog tegen komt op de nieuwe pc's.
Hij is niet goedkoop. Maar zeker wel snel en klaar voor de toekomst.
HWUSB Dongle
Updated 02-07-2010 | © 2005-2010 René van Dorst. | Sitemap